Mortgage refinance companies in Strongsville Ohio help homeowners lower their interest rates or change loan terms. Ohio law requires lenders to provide a Loan Estimate within three business days of application. Strongsville residents can work with local brokers or direct lenders to refinance their home loans.
What Does a Mortgage Refinance Company in Strongsville Cost?
Typical costs for a mortgage refinance in Ohio range from 2 percent to 5 percent of the loan amount. For a 200,000 dollar loan, this means 4,000 to 10,000 dollars in fees including appraisal, title search, and origination charges. Costs vary by lender and loan type. Frequently Asked Questions
What documents do I need to refinance my mortgage in Strongsville Ohio?
You typically need pay stubs, tax returns, bank statements, and proof of homeowners insurance. Ohio lenders also require a property appraisal to confirm home value.
How long does a mortgage refinance take in Ohio?
A standard refinance in Ohio usually takes 30 to 45 days from application to closing. Ohio law does not set a specific time limit, but lenders must provide a Closing Disclosure at least three business days before closing.
Are there Ohio specific rules for mortgage refinancing?
Yes. Ohio Revised Code Section 1321.55 requires mortgage brokers to be licensed and disclose all fees. Ohio also has a three day right of rescission for refinances on your primary residence.
